Shillong (Meghalaya), April 02 : In a groundbreaking achievement, Khasi-language film “Ha Lyngkha Bneng” (The Elysian Field), directed by Pradip Kurbah, has been selected for the Main Competition at the prestigious 47th Moscow International Film Festival (MIFF) 2025!
This historic milestone marks the first time a Khasi film has been showcased at one of the world’s oldest and most esteemed film festivals, established in 1935. The festival will take place in Moscow from April 17 to April 24, featuring the finest films from around the globe.
Produced by Kurbah Films in association with Hello Meghalaya, Pomus New Horizons, Ka Knup Creatives, and Cat N Mouse Entertainment, the film boasts a talented cast, including Richard Kharpuri, Helena Duiia, and Baia Marbaniang.
This selection at MIFF 2025 is a testament to the growing recognition of Khasi cinema on the global stage.
